Payrav Chorshanbiyev

DUSHANBE, April 30, 2013, Asia-Plus  — An exhibition of export goods from China’s Xinjiang Uyghur Autonomous Region (XUAR) is expected to take place in Dushanbe from September 20-23 this year.

This issue was discussed here yesterday at a meeting of Sharif Said, Chairman of Tajikistan’s Chamber of Commerce and Industry (CCI), with a delegation of China’s Xinjiang Uyghur Autonomous Region (XUAR), led by Sya Guantai (phonetically spelled), Director General, Department of Commerce, XUAR of China.  

The CCI press center reports the sides discussed organizational issues related to preparations for the upcoming exhibition of export goods from XUAR.

Since 2004, similar exhibitions have taken place in Dushanbe, Kulob, Danghara, Gorno Badakhshan and other regions of Tajikistan.

In the course of the talks, Tajik CCI head outlined sectors like hydropower, minerals, light industry and agriculture, as areas of which could drive the bilateral trade between Tajikistan and the Xinjiang Uyghur Autonomous Region of China.

According to him, the sides could also cooperate in developing the farm produce processing industry in Tajikistan.

“Tajikistan is also interested in cooperation with Chinese companies on construction of roads and tunnels,” the CCI head said.

Over the past ten days, a two-way trade between Tajikistan and China has reportedly increased from 32 million U.S. dollars to 2 billion U.S. dollars.
